From the name of this system it is clear that Vodomet-Dom is focused specifically on the domestic sphere. Moreover, four models of the Vodomet-Dom system allow to cover literally the entire niche: from small buildings (country houses) served by the 60/32 model to low-rise dwellings (cottages and townhouses) equipped with the 60/92 model.

And pay attention: the performance of the Vodomet-Dom system is stable in both cases. After all, both the younger and older models pump about 60 liters of water per minute (determined by the first two-digit figure in the model name).

Well, the difference between these models lies in the head, which is 32 and 92 meters (determined by the last two-digit figure in the model name). That is, we have in front of us a high-performance system with the ability to adjust the height of the water column.


Of course, such attractive characteristics did not appear out of nowhere. Vodomet-Dom has a very attractive design, since the pumping unit of this autonomous water supply system can be both submersible and surface (main).

And in the first case, Vodomet-Dom pumps water even from 100-mm wells filled not with liquid, but with a suspension containing 1-2 kilograms of sand per 1000 liters of water. In the second case, the pump is integrated into the line itself, using a special fitting, which allows you to assemble a surface pumping station that works even in severe frosts. However, such a pump can only pump relatively clean water, with a sand content of not more than 300 grams per 1000 liters.

Another advantage of the Vodomet-Dom system is a giant 50-liter hydroaccumulator, which can meet the current needs of a fairly large family or several families living in an apartment cottage at once.

The standard delivery set of the Vodomet-Dom system includes the following units:

  • Hydraulic accumulator for 50 liters.
  • Submersible pump"Vodomet" or the main pump "Vodomet M".
  • Filter unit with wear-resistant housing.
  • A set of shut-off and control valves, which includes such assemblies as a three-way union, a ball valve and check valve.
  • A control unit with protection against voltage surges (the station operates only in the range from 160 to 250 Volts) and a control and measuring unit (pressure gauge).

The cost of the Vodomet-Dom set ranges from 17 to 24 thousand rubles. Manufacturer - Dzhileks company (Russia).

The Vodomet Chastotnik station was created to please consumers with “above average” requests. After all, this unit works with twice the performance than a model from the Vodomet House series.

Moreover, four models of the "Vodomet Chastotnik" series are focused on both domestic and commercial needs. After all, the "youngest" model - 115/75-Ch - pumps out from a 30-meter well up to 115 liters of water per minute, supplying it with a pressure of 75 meters. And this is quite enough for water supply of multi-apartment low-rise buildings (townhouse).

The older model - 125/125-CH - draws water from the same deep well, but with a capacity of 125 liters per minute, it provides a head of 125 meters. And such characteristics can be used even in public utilities or in handicraft production.

Moreover, all stations from the Vodomet Chastotnik series are equipped with special submersible pumps Vodomet-Ch, which are automatically controlled with the help of a unit built in by the manufacturer. And such a unit provides a smooth flow of liquid with the required pressure, regardless of the water flow rate. In addition, the Vodomet-Ch units have a built-in dry-running protection unit and a soft start unit, which increases the duration of the trouble-free period of operation.

The capacity of the accumulator of the pumping station "Vodomet Chastotnik" is 50 or 100 liters. Moreover, a more capacious drive is installed on older models equipped with pumps with a power of more than 1.5 kW. And a 50-liter tank is installed on the younger models, which are equipped with pumps with a capacity of about one kilowatt.

In addition to the tank and the pump, the Vodomet Chastotnik station kit includes the following components:

  • The control unit with its own pressure switch (RDM-5), equipped with a voltage stabilizer, equalizing the characteristics of the current. Therefore, the station works without interruptions even in conditions far from ideal - at voltages from 160 to 250 Volts.
  • A set of shut-off valves, which includes a ball valve and a check valve (it prevents water from draining into the well)
  • A set of control and control valves, which includes a three-outlet choke (flow distributor mounted on the neck of the accumulator) and a pressure gauge.

The cost of a station from the Vodomet Chastotnik series ranges from 27 to 40 thousand rubles. Manufacturer - Dzhileks company (Russia).

Grundfos is a very respectable Danish company producing high quality pumping equipment. Moreover, according to the assurances of the company, it is related to every second unit sold in the global compressor equipment market.

Well, in the segment of downhole equipment, Grundfos has strengthened itself thanks to the well-known series of SQE household stations. Moreover, the SQE deep water pumps from Grundfos are famous for both their quality and performance. Indeed, even the "younger" models from this series are able to "reach" from a considerable depth up to 9000 liters of liquid per hour, lifting it with a 50-meter pressure.

However, the SQE series from Grundfos also has some drawbacks that prevent these units from being promoted to the first place in our rating. And such disadvantages include, firstly, the high price - the average cost of the SQE kit from Grundfos is 50,000 rubles, and, secondly, the small volume of the accumulator, equal to 8-10 liters. Besides, repairing such an expensive station cannot be cheap. And given the remoteness of the manufacturer of "spare parts", it will not be available either.

But Grundfos guarantees that the service life of the SQE series stations will exceed 10 years. A block automatic control the water supply system will provide not only protection against dry running, but also the smooth start-up of the "aggregate" part of the station.

The scope of delivery for the Grundfos SQE series is standard. It includes a submersible pump, a hydraulic accumulator, an automation unit, shut-off and control valves.

The cost of a station from the SQE Grundfos series ranges from 40 to 60 thousand rubles. Manufacturer - Grundfos (Denmark).

A mandatory requirement for water supply systems is the minimum pump starts - recommended for all well-known brands - no more than 10 times per hour - remember that the useful volume of the GA is approximately 0.3 of the nominal - with a properly configured GA of 100 liters, you will get the maximum before turning on the pump 20-30 liters - this must be taken into account, as well as the upper switch-off point of the pump - it must be calculated so that during intensive parsing - for example, washing in the shower or watering the garden (pouring into barrels) - the pump does not turn off - find the equilibrium point of the system and turn off just above this point.
It is imperative not to narrow the feed system, which is at least 1 inch (or 32 PND) to GA.

The centrifugal submersible pump "Vodomet" is a multistage electric pump with "floating" impellers, "washed" by an electric motor and a built-in capacitor. The submersible pump Vodomet is designed to supply water from wells with an inner diameter of 100 mm or more, as well as wells, reservoirs and open reservoirs for the water supply system of the house, irrigation of the garden and vegetable garden.

Peculiarities:

Submersible pumps "VODOMET" in comparison with vibratory pumps:

  • have greater efficiency, since the rotary motion is more economical than the reciprocating one due to the absence of the "start-stop" mode;
  • submersible pumps are less noisy;
  • submersible pumps are much more durable, since they do not have a quickly wearing valve-piston system;
  • Submersible pumps do not have a harmful effect on the well and the entire water supply system, since they do not have significant vibration. Silence is one of the most important features of the Vodomet pump: the house will not be filled with extraneous noise during its operation.

Borehole pumps"VODOMET" in comparison with vortex:

  • borehole pumps are more efficient;
  • are not subject to changes in parameters over time, while in vortex pumps, wear of the working surfaces reduces the flow-pressure characteristic;
  • borehole pumps are less noisy;
  • borehole pumps are not as sensitive to contamination.

The "VODOMET" pump with "floating" impellers in comparison with traditional ones:

  • has a higher hydraulic efficiency due to self-setting of "zero" clearances, which increases the pressure characteristic of each impeller. This reduces the required amount, i.e. axial dimensions of the pump, mass of rotating parts, and, consequently, vibrations are reduced;
  • has a lower tendency to clogging, as it is able to pass large particles. The Vodomet system is ideal for domestic use: the house will always have a working water supply system.

Pumps "VODOMET" with a "washable" electric motor have a number of advantages over devices of a traditional layout:

  • the location of the electric motor above the pumping part allows the power cable to be removed from the upper cover of the pump, which reduces its dimensions and allows the pump to be mounted in a well with a casing of a smaller diameter (it is cheaper);
  • the electric motor of the borehole pump is reliably protected from overheating by the flow of water that washes it, which passes through the annular gap between the stator shell and the pump casing;
  • the location of the seal at the highest point of the hydraulic part of the pump protects it from the ingress of sand, and, therefore, significantly increases the service life;
  • the design of the pump allows it to be used in a partially submerged position, for example, in open shallow bodies of water.
  • VODOMET submersible pumps with a built-in condenser eliminate the condenser box and allow the use of a conventional three-core cable instead of a four-core cable, which simplifies installation.
  • the use of a mesh (1.5x1.5 mm) filter instead of a slotted filter more effectively prevents the penetration of long particles into the pump, which can clog the pump. All parts of the pump that come into contact with the pumped water are made of materials approved for contact with food.

The main components of the VODOMET DOM automated water supply system: a submersible pump of the VODOMET series, a control panel with a pressure sensor, a 50 l hydraulic accumulator. made of carbon steel, filter housing 10 ", check valve, ball valve, pressure gauge, unions.
